Old Trail Rancho
Neighborhood in Hesperia, California
San Bernardino County 92345
The neighborhood's lots are an acre-plus
The ranch-style residences in Old Trail Rancho often come with at least an acre of land, providing plenty of room for a horse or a backyard pool. Most homes average about 1,900 square feet and were built from the 1950s through the early 2000s. Prices in this area range from $345,000 to $600,000, based on factors including square footage and condition.The county fair is an anticipated event
The neighboring city of Victorville is the site of the 84-acre San Bernardino County Fair and Event Center, located about 9 miles from Old Trail Rancho. The center hosts the San Bernardino County Fair, which dates back roughly 80 years. The event occurs around Memorial Day and features rides, music, food, animal exhibits and a demolition derby. Another nearly 80-year-old tradition is the Hesperia Days Parade, which travels along Main Street. The September parade chooses different themes each year, like “Step Into the Spirit of the Wild West” and “A Day in Hollywood: Making Movie Magic.”Local thoroughfares feature restaurants, markets
People around Old Trail Rancho are within 3 miles of Main Street and 6 miles of Bear Valley Road. “Those are the main two roads where [you'll find] entertainment and food,” Bolin says. Main Street is part of the city’s downtown and features restaurants like Los Pollos Bros, whose drinks are popular. Havanazucar Cuban Restaurant offers a Sunday brunch buffet, and Hole In One Donuts serves up sweets from 3 a.m. to 9 p.m. daily. Cardenas Markets, Stater Bros. Markets and Walmart are also along this stretch. The Mall of Victor Valley on Bear Valley Road has dozens of stores, including Macy’s and Dick’s Sporting Goods. Other large retailers close by include Best Buy, Lowe’s, The Home Depot and Kohl’s.Maple Park and Hesperia Community Park are sports hubs
Old Trail Rancho is roughly 2 miles from Maple Park and 3 miles from Hesperia Community Park. Maple Park is a draw for youth soccer, offering multiple fields. Hesperia Community Park has eight ball fields and hosts baseball and softball games. Locals can head to Hesperia’s outskirts for trails and other outdoor amenities. “People ride horses on the weekend,” Bolin says, and Mojave Narrows Regional Park, 11 miles away in Victorville, is a popular spot for riding. Mojave Narrows also features trails open to horse riding, as well as two fishing lakes and an 18-hole disc golf course.Interstate 15 offers direct routes to the airport, major cities
Residents are about 4 miles from Interstate 15, the area’s major highway. I-15 includes a stretch known as the Cajon Pass in Hesperia, which passes through the San Bernardino and San Gabriel mountains. Drivers can take I-15 to San Bernardino and the San Bernardino International Airport, just under 40 miles away. Multiple bus stops are stationed along Main Street in Old Trail Rancho.Cottonwood Elementary offers special events, local high schools provide CTE courses
The Hesperia Unified School District carries a B-minus rating on Niche. Old Trail Rancho is zoned for the neighborhood's C-rated Cottonwood Elementary School. Cottonwood organizes activities for students and their families, including Howlfest for Halloween, a Daddy & Me Dance, a Mommy & Me Paint Night and movie nights. Students go to the C-plus-rated Cedar Middle or C-rated Hesperia Junior High for Grades 7 and 8, depending on where they live. Both Cedar Middle and Hesperia Junior High offer several sports teams, from basketball to wrestling. Students attend A-minus-rated Oak Hills High or B-plus-rated Hesperia High, and both have career technical education courses in criminal justice, culinary arts and digital design.

Old Trail Rancho Demographics and Home Trends
On average, homes in Old Trail Rancho, Hesperia sell after 40 days on the market compared to the national average of 49 days. The median sale price for homes in Old Trail Rancho, Hesperia over the last 12 months is $515,000, up 1% from the median home sale price over the previous 12 months.
